The South Africa battery packaging market is experiencing significant growth driven by the expanding demand for batteries across various industries such as automotive, electronics, and renewable energy storage. The market is characterized by the increasing adoption of advanced packaging solutions to ensure the safety and efficiency of batteries. Key trends in the market include the shift towards sustainable and recyclable packaging materials, as well as the integration of smart packaging technologies for improved performance monitoring. Key players in the South Africa battery packaging market are focusing on innovations in design and materials to meet the evolving requirements of the battery industry. With the rising emphasis on energy storage solutions and increasing investments in renewable energy projects, the South Africa battery packaging market is poised for continued growth in the coming years.

In the South Africa Battery Packaging Market, some key challenges include the high cost of materials and production processes, as well as the stringent regulatory requirements for packaging materials and waste disposal. Additionally, the market faces issues related to ensuring the safety and security of battery packaging to prevent leakages and environmental contamination. Another challenge is the need for continuous innovation in packaging design to enhance the performance and longevity of batteries while also meeting sustainability goals. Furthermore, the competitive landscape and the need to differentiate packaging solutions to meet the diverse needs of various industries add complexity to the market. Overall, overcoming these challenges will require a combination of technological advancements, regulatory compliance, and strategic partnerships within the industry.

The South African government has implemented various policies related to the battery packaging market to promote sustainable practices and environmental protection. These policies include regulations on the recycling and disposal of batteries to minimize environmental impact and prevent pollution. Additionally, there are guidelines in place to ensure the safe handling and transportation of batteries to reduce potential risks to health and safety. The government also encourages the use of eco-friendly and recyclable materials in battery packaging to promote a more sustainable industry. Overall, these policies aim to create a more environmentally conscious and responsible battery packaging market in South Africa.
